温馨提示×

hive stored函数的安全性如何

小樊
81
2024-12-19 21:01:49
栏目: 大数据

Hive存储函数(UDF)的安全性是一个重要的考虑因素,特别是在处理敏感数据时。以下是对Hive存储函数安全性的详细分析:

Hive存储函数的安全风险

Hive存储函数本身并不直接导致安全风险,但如果不正确地设计和使用,可能会引入安全漏洞。例如,不安全的代码实现可能会导致SQL注入攻击,或者在不安全的环境中执行敏感操作,如访问或修改关键数据。

Hive的安全特性

Hive提供了一系列安全特性来降低潜在的安全风险,包括:

  • 访问控制:通过配置登录认证方式和访问控制列表(ACL)来实现。
  • 数据加密:支持透明数据加密(TDE)和列级加密,确保数据在存储和传输过程中的安全。
  • 安全规范:通过数据加密、审计、设置防火墙策略等主动的安全手段对数据安全进行增强、监控、屏蔽。
  • 管理安全:在企业数据的日常管理维护范围内,充分地保证数据安全,例如文件管理、数据结构调整、系统升级等。

最佳实践

  • 合理设计表结构:选择合适的分区和桶策略,避免单表数据量过大。
  • 优化查询性能:使用合适的索引、分区裁剪、预计算等技术。
  • 数据清洗和预处理:在将数据加载到Hive之前,进行数据清洗和预处理。
  • 监控和调优:持续监控和调优Hive系统,及时发现和解决性能瓶颈。

安全风险和最佳实践的重要性

了解Hive的安全风险和采取最佳实践对于确保Hive存储函数的安全性至关重要。通过上述分析,我们可以看到Hive在数据安全方面采取了一系列措施,包括访问控制、数据加密和安全规范等。同时,遵循最佳实践可以帮助用户进一步提高Hive系统的安全性。

请注意,以上信息仅供参考,具体情况可能因实际部署和使用环境而异。在实施任何安全措施之前,建议进行详细的安全评估,并考虑咨询专业的网络安全专家。

0